Who is Introduction to Residential Experiences for?
Introduction to Residential Experiences is for volunteers who may organise or support residential experiences for young people as part of their role in Scouting. It is intended to provide an introduction to residential experiences.

By attending this course you will be able to:

  • Explain the role that residential experiences have in the development of young people in Scouting.
  • Describe the organisation and administration of residential experiences.
  • Identify the skills required within a team running a residential experience.
  • Describe the Nights Away Permit scheme, including where to locate support and further information whilst planning a residential experience.

The validation of this module is based on your ability to meet the criteria. This means the adult will need to demonstrate an understanding of the role of residential experiences in Scouting.
